Amazon Brandstore / Storefront

Boost your brand’s visibility like never before! Let’s discuss your Amazon Storefront project!

Our Portfolio

See how we design custom Amazon storefronts that look great and drive better sales with our expert Amazon store design services

Why you should have an Amazon Store

Having an Amazon storefront is crucial for any brand looking to stand out in a crowded marketplace. However, a Premium Amazon storefront offers a professional, branded experience that sets you apart from other sellers. Thus, it allows you to organize and showcase your products effectively, improving customer engagement. Thus, with a well-designed Amazon brand store, Moreover, you can highlight key offerings, run promotions, and create a consistent shopping experience. Additionally, optimizing your Amazon store design ensures better visibility, searchability, and ultimately higher conversion rates, making it an essential tool for increasing sales and building brand loyalty.

Amazon Storefront

Resourses

FAQs

Who can create an Amazon Brand Store?

 Only brand-registered sellers, vendors, and agencies enrolled in Amazon Brand Registry can create a Storefront, ensuring only verified brands can build a unique presence.

 We recommend at least 4 pages to showcase your products, brand story, and offers. The ideal number depends on your catalog size and product categories. Let’s discuss the best approach!

 Meta Tag Optimization uses relevant keywords to boost your Storefront’s visibility on Amazon and search engines, driving traffic and improving conversions.

 A Storefront offers a visually appealing space to showcase your brand, enhancing visibility and credibility. It attracts traffic, boosts sales, and encourages repeat visitors through a seamless shopping experience.

 Brand Store Insights helps you track sales, visits, page views, and traffic sources. You can also measure external traffic with tagged URLs for better optimization.